Parents' Right To Know

The Federal Every Student Succeeds Act (ESSA) contains several provisions that promote a parent/school partnership through communication. One such provision gives parents of Title I school students the right to ask for and receive information about the professional qualifications of their child’s classroom teacher, paraprofessional, and/or long-term substitute teacher. Join Band or Strings

Students in 3rd and 4th grade will be attending assemblies about the band and orchestra instruments that they can learn to play this year. Students in 3rd grade may participate in orchestra, and students in 4th and 5th grade may participate in band or orchestra.
